Embracing Change: Life Goes On and So Should You



Life is a beautiful and unpredictable journey filled with ups and downs, twists and turns. Change is an inevitable part of this journey, and as the saying goes, "life goes on." In this blog article, we will explore the concept of life continuing amidst change and provide insights on how to embrace and navigate through life's transitions. So, let's dive in and discover how we can adapt, grow, and thrive as we embrace the ever-changing nature of life.

Acknowledge the Unpredictability of Life:Life is not always smooth sailing. Unexpected events, setbacks, and challenges are bound to occur. It's essential to acknowledge that change is a constant companion in our lives. By recognising this truth, we can adopt a mindset that allows us to be more flexible, adaptable, and open to new possibilities.

Embrace the Power of Resilience:Resilience is the ability to bounce back from adversity and keep moving forward. Cultivating resilience is key to navigating through life's challenges. By developing coping mechanisms, such as maintaining a positive mindset, seeking support from loved ones, and practicing self-care, we can build the inner strength necessary to weather any storm that comes our way.

Find Meaning in Transitions:Life's transitions often bring about significant change, whether it's starting a new job, moving to a different city, or experiencing a personal loss. Instead of resisting these changes, try to find meaning and opportunities for growth within them. Embrace the chance to learn, develop new skills, and gain valuable experiences that shape your character.

Practice Mindfulness and Gratitude:In the midst of change, it's easy to get caught up in the whirlwind of emotions or to become overwhelmed by uncertainty. Mindfulness can help us stay grounded in the present moment, fostering a sense of calm and acceptance. Additionally, cultivating gratitude for what we have in our lives, even during challenging times, can shift our perspective and bring a renewed sense of appreciation and contentment.

Set Goals and Adapt:While change can be unsettling, it also presents an opportunity for growth. By setting goals and embracing change as a catalyst for progress, we can channel our energy towards positive outcomes. Adaptability is a valuable skill that allows us to adjust our plans and strategies as circumstances change. Remember that flexibility and a willingness to try new approaches can lead to unexpected opportunities and achievements.

Nurture Relationships:In times of change, it's crucial to lean on the support of loved ones. Strengthening relationships and maintaining a support network can provide a sense of stability and comfort during uncertain times. Share your experiences, seek advice, and offer support to others facing their own transitions. Together, we can navigate the ebb and flow of life's journey.

Life is a continuous process of growth and change. Instead of fearing or resisting change, we should embrace it as an opportunity for personal and emotional development. By cultivating resilience, practicing mindfulness, setting goals, and nurturing relationships, we can adapt to life's transitions with grace and optimism. Remember, life goes on, and so should you. Embrace change, seize opportunities, and live each moment to the fullest.
